Newbie here. I’m looking for a place to handpick dry rock (perferibly caribsea) any suggestions?
If you're willing to put the work into it, you don't need to handpick. You just need a bunch of rock, a hammer, chisel, some super-thin superglue and some calcium carbonate powder. Now you're limited only by your creativity!
